Wyoming Highway 273 (WYO 273) is a short 0.33-mile-long (0.53 km) north–south Wyoming State Road, known as County Club Road, located in south-central Niobrara County two miles west of Lusk.
Route description
At only 0.33 miles (0.53 km) in length, Wyoming Highway 273 acts as a spur from US 18/US 20 north to the Lusk Municipal Golf Course, just west of Lusk.[2]
